Mogadore waltzed into their matchup on Tuesday with three straight wins... but they left with four. Everything went their way against the Aquinas Knights as they made off with a 3-0 win. That looming 3-0 mark stands out as the most commanding margin for the Wildcats yet this season.
Not only was the match a shutout, it was a big one: Mogadore took every set by at least 11 points. The match finished with set scores of 25-14, 25-6, 25-11.
Emma Buter paced Mogadore's offense, picking up 15 kills. Buter got some help from Kaitlyn Clester and her 15 assists. Gracie Shull controlled things from the service line, finishing with five aces.
Mogadore's victory bumped their record up to 4-0. As for Aquinas, they are on a 21-game losing streak (dating back to last season) that has dropped them down to 0-5.
Mogadore didn't take long to hit the court again: they've already played their next contest, a 3-2 win against John F. Kennedy Catholic on the 28th. Aquinas has also already played their next game (against Lake Center Christian), but no score has been uploaded at the time of writing.
